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Furze Platt to Lancaster start from as little as £41.80

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Furze Platt to Lancaster start from £88.60 one way, or £126.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Furze Platt to Lancaster are available for £92.30 one way, or £184.60 return

Facilities and Accessibility

At Furze Platt, ticket purchasing is streamlined with operational ticket machines available, although it's worth noting that tickets bought online cannot be collected at this station. The station is equipped to issue smartcards but doesn't provide validators. Accessibility features include step-free access through a short steep ramp, ensuring those with mobility needs are accommodated. However, accessible facilities such as toilets and car park equipment are not available. The station is under CCTV surveillance for safety!

Staff and Support

During the weekdays, from 06:45 to 11:30, staff are on hand to offer help from a designated help point, ready to facilitate a smooth and stress-free travel experience. While there are no luggage storage facilities, rest assured that you can seek assistance and real-time updates from the customer information systems available on-site. Furze Platt might not boast lounge areas or Wi-Fi access, but it ensures essential support for its commuters.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Lancaster Train Station is equipped with a range of facilities designed to enhance the traveler's journey. A welcoming ticket office is open daily from early morning until late evening and is complemented by ticket machines for those who prefer self-service. There’s good news for online purchasers too, as you can easily collect your tickets from the machines available on site. If accessibility is a priority, the station offers step-free access to all platforms, ensuring that everyone can navigate the station with ease. Additional support such as ramps, accessible ticket machines, and induction loops further enhance the station’s inclusivity.

Furthermore, the station aims to support travelers with amenities like accessible toilets and baby changing facilities. Waiting for your train doesn’t mean you’ll be left standing, as waiting rooms and ample seating arrangements are provided. Though there are no first-class lounges, everyone can enjoy the comfort offered in the waiting areas on platforms 3, 4, and 5.

Onward Travel and Connectivity

Once you’re ready to continue your journey from Lancaster, there are several transport options available to make your onward journey effortless. Taxis are conveniently located adjacent to platform 3, and for those who prefer a scenic route, Lancaster’s bus connections are readily available with an accessible rail replacement service area nearby. For cyclists, the station offers covered bicycle stands and even bicycle hire through Leisure Lakes Bikes, providing 188 cycle spaces spread across the platforms.
